The NX1117C285Z is a state-of-the-art low dropout linear voltage regulator by NXP Semiconductors, designed to deliver a high level of performance for a wide range of applications. This particular model is engineered to provide a fixed output voltage of 2.85V, making it an ideal choice for powering sensitive electronic circuits that require a stable and precise voltage supply.
Key Features
- Output Voltage: Fixed at 2.85V, providing precise voltage regulation for critical applications.
- High Current Capability: Capable of delivering up to 1A of continuous output current, making it suitable for high-power applications.
- Low Dropout Voltage: The NX1117C285Z boasts a low dropout voltage, ensuring efficient operation even when the input voltage is close to the output voltage.
- Thermal Protection: Integrated thermal shutdown mechanism protects the device and the load from damage due to excessive heat.
- Short-Circuit Protection: Built-in short-circuit protection enhances the safety and reliability of the device under fault conditions.
- Low Quiescent Current: The regulator's design focuses on energy efficiency, with a low quiescent current that reduces power consumption when in standby mode.
